Output 2e7ebb95b5aa7aa1df7e0f1b66e586273c1dba94976276e1d5431ec7fdf7f042:120

value
454000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a9be997bf8ba01eb598f78fcb2bf4c54634c91 OP_EQUAL
address
3Dy3pJgdqrp8HtwSnCfQybxDp3qyijTeNX
transaction
2e7ebb95b5aa7aa1df7e0f1b66e586273c1dba94976276e1d5431ec7fdf7f042
confirmations
190291
spent
true